The kelvin, along with the ampere, kilogramme and the mole are likely to be redefined in terms of fundamental constants, in line with Conférence Générale des Poids et Mesures (CGPM) resolution 1 (2011) [1, 2], sometime before 2020. In advance of the redefinition a mise en pratique of the definition of the kelvin (MeP-K) is currently being prepared [3]. The Implementing the new Kelvin (InK) project [4] will coordinate activity in this field with the objective of improving primary thermometry over the range from 0.0009 K to 3000+K. The project will facilitate realisation and dissemination by primary thermometry of high (>1300 K) and low (<1 K) temperatures, the determination of the world's lowest uncertainty values of T-T90, and re-evaluation of T - T2000.
